Abstract:
This is the Japanese translation of E.H. Chamberlin's article 'An Experimental Imperfect Market' (1948). The article analyzed the results of those experiments which he had conducted in his course at Harvard University and showed that the prices and trading volumes in the experiments deviated from the equilibrium predicted by the standard supply and demand theory. For this contribution, he is often cited as one of the most important precursors in experimental economics (Smith 1962).
